About Weaver Creek Cutoff
Weaver Creek Cutoff is a natural lake or pond in Mississippi, United States. It covers approximately 10.37 km² (2562 acres). The lake centroid is located at 33.8846° N, 88.5287° W. Fish species records for this lake are still being compiled. Lake boundary and identifier come from the USGS National Hydrography Dataset.
